Battery configurations having through-pack fasteners

1. A battery comprising:
a first circuit board defining a first aperture through the first circuit board;
a battery cell overlying the first circuit board and including:
an anode current collector including an anode active material;
a cathode current collector including a cathode active material;
a separator positioned between the anode current collector and the cathode current collector;
an electrolyte in contact with the anode current collector and the cathode current collector;
an opening formed through the battery cell and extending through the anode current collector, the cathode current collector and the separator; and
a seal formed around a periphery of the opening and arranged to prevent the electrolyte from entering the opening;
a second circuit board overlying the battery cell and defining a second aperture through the second circuit board; and
a fastener extending through the first aperture, the opening and the second aperture.
